Job Title:
Sr Manager, Sales Commissions
Position Summary
The Sr Manager, Sales Commissions is accountable for the accurate calculation, accounting, and payment of sales commissions in a public company, SOX-compliant environment. Reporting to the Corporate Controller, this role owns commission-related accounting judgments, internal controls, and audit support, while partnering closely with Sales Operations to ensure compensation plans are executed in accordance with approved terms. This position requires a strong technical accounting foundation, rigorous control mindset, the ability to operate effectively in a highly regulated reporting environment, and the ability to understand complex sales commissions structures.
Key Responsibilities
Sales Commission Accounting
-
Own all accounting for sales commissions, including expense recognition, accruals, deferrals, amortization, true-ups and technical memos.
-
Ensure commissions are accounted for in accordance with U.S. GAAP, including ASC 606 capitalization and amortization of incremental contract acquisition costs.
-
Review and approve commission-related journal entries and supporting schedules.
-
Reconcile commission expense, accrual, and deferred commission balances; investigate and resolve variances timely.
-
Ensure accurate and complete commission balances are reflected in mon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ements.
-
Coordinate closely with FP&A on commission forecasting, accrual assumptions, and variance analysis.
-
Support disclosures related to sales commissions and contract acquisition costs.
-
Ensure commission accounting timelines align with corporate close and reporting deadlines
